4 - | Outside temperature switch -F38- |
q | Removal → Fig. |
q | Disconnect the magnetic coupling -N25- for too low outside temperatures (disconnect at 2 °C, connect at 7 °C) |
q | Clipped in the middle of the plenum chamber |

8 - | Coolant temperature sender -G62- |
q | In the thermostat |
q | -G62- disconnect the magnetic coupling -N25- for too high temperatures of the coolant (disconnect at 119 °C, connect at 112 °C) |
9 - | Two way valve for fresh air and air recirculation flap -N63- |
q | With the created pressure and the existing vacuum, the depressor closes the flap |
q | When the pressure is not created or the vacuum existant, the depressor opens the flap |

15 - | Pressure sender -G65- or air conditioning pressure switch -F129- |
q | Removal → Fig. |
q | 8 Nm |
q | Substitute the O-gasket (observe the spare part number) |
q | The pressure sender and the pressure switch can be replaced without having to extract the coolant agent of the circuit |
q | The pressure sender -G65- sends information to the radiator fan control unit -J293- and the engine control unit |
q | Test the air conditioning pressure sender -G65- → Chapter |
q | Check the air conditioning pressure switch -F129- → Chapter |
Function: |
t | Disconnects the air conditioning if the pressure is too low (e.g. in the case of coolant agent leak) |
t | Changes the coolant agent radiator fan -V7- to the next higher speed in case of pressure increase in the coolant agent circuit |
